Property Overview: 498 Hartford Avenue, Winnipeg

Key Characteristics & Appeal

This is a compact, single-storey home built in 1955, situated on a notably generous lot in the Jefferson neighbourhood. With 942 sqft of living space, it is a comfortably sized home for its local area, though below the city-wide average. Its key updated feature is a renovated basement, adding functional space, and it includes a detached garage. The property’s standout attribute is its land: at 5,783 sqft, the lot size is well above average for both Hartford Avenue and the broader Jefferson area, offering significant outdoor space and potential.

The appeal lies in its balance of a modest, manageable home on a substantial parcel of land. It suits first-time buyers or downsizers looking for a lower-maintenance, one-storey layout without sacrificing yard space for gardening, children, or pets. The renovated basement adds valuable flexibility for a home office, guest space, or storage. For an investor or renovator, the large lot presents a clear long-term opportunity, whether for expansion, landscaping, or future redevelopment, making it a property where the land itself is a primary asset.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How does the assessed value relate to likely market price?
The assessed value is a municipal figure for tax purposes and is typically lower than market value. The most recent sold price range (early 2024) provides a more current benchmark for the home’s market worth.

2. What does the "renovated basement" entail?
The listing confirms the basement is renovated but does not specify the scope. A prospective buyer should inquire about the finish quality, permits, moisture control, and the specific use of the space (e.g., rec room, suite, storage).

3. Is the large lot a benefit for future expansion?
Potentially, yes. The lot size is a key feature of this property. However, any significant expansion or new structure would be subject to local zoning bylaws, setback requirements, and permitting. Its size does create more options than a standard lot.
